  • Publication number: 20060226745
    Abstract: An operation panel 40 is prepared in the following manner. First, components are mounted in mounting holes 14a, 14c to 14e, and 14g to 14o of a base member 12, and other mounting holes 14b, 14f, 14p, and 14q are left vacant without mounting components therein. Next, a plate member 26 that is provided with exposing holes 20a, 20c to 20e, 20g to 20o to expose components outside at positions opposed to the mounting holes 14a, 14c to 14e, and 14g to 14o in which the components have been mounted and is provided with no exposing holes at positions opposed to vacant mounting holes 14b, 14f, 14p, and 14q is prepared. The plate member 26 is integrated with the base member 12 by covering a component mounting surface 14 with the plate member 26 and fitting respective hooks 24 into respective hook latching holes 16.

  • Publication number: 20060017068
    Abstract: An integrated circuit includes an on-chip memory having bit lines, which is formed in a metal layer; and an embedded passage wiring that is arranged in the metal layer or above so as to avoid a cross-talk noise with the bit lines. The embedded passage wiring is electrically connected to predetermined terminals to route a signal line over the on-chip memory.

  • Publication number: 20050288659
    Abstract: An ultrasonic surgical apparatus comprises a treatment device with an ultrasonic transducer driven to generate ultrasonic vibration, an operation device outputting a signal commanding the transducer to start driving in response to an operator's operation, and a driver driving the transducer by supplying current thereto. The apparatus further comprises a controller controlling the driver. The controller controls the driver using selectively a first output control pattern and a second output control pattern. The first output control pattern is set to supply the current of a first current value under control of constant current control in response to the signal from the operation device, while the second output control pattern is set to supply the current of a second current value in response to the signal from the operation device and then the current is reduced in amount as the time counted from starting the supply elapses.

  • Publication number: 20050222560
    Abstract: An operative instrument includes forceps having a treating section for treating an anatomy at an extremity and being provided with a heat-generating body for generating heat to be provided to the anatomy and a power supply unit for supplying electric power to the heat-generating body of the forceps. The operative instrument raises the temperature of the heat-generating body by supplying substantially constant electric power to the heat-generating body. Therefore, coagulation and incision of the anatomy can be performed satisfactorily.

  • Patent number: 6785060
    Abstract: A reflecting-type optical system according to the invention includes an optical element composed of a transparent body having an entrance surface, an exit surface and at least three curved reflecting surfaces of internal reflection. A light beam coming from an object and entering at the entrance surface is reflected from at least one of the reflecting surfaces to form a primary image within the optical element and is, then, made to exit from the exit surface through the remaining reflecting surfaces to form an object image on a predetermined plane. In the optical system, 70% or more of the length of a reference axis in the optical element lies in one plane.
